Below is a quick overview to help you select the right 3D Printing process based on part function, material, and production needs.

High-resolution resin printing for visual and precision prototypes. Best for: appearance models, fine details, smooth surfaces. Materials: engineering resins Tolerance: ±0.1–0.2 mm

HP MJF uses a fusing agent and heat to create strong, functional parts with fine details and excellent mechanical properties. Tolerance for nylon parts: ISO 2768-CL

SLS fuses powdered material layer by layer using a laser, producing robust and durable parts. It’s excellent for complex geometries and end-use applications.

SLM melts metal powders with a laser to create high-strength, intricate metal parts. This process is ideal for aerospace, medical, and industrial applications.
We provide a comprehensive overview of each rapid 3D printing process’s unique standards, aiding in informed decisions for your printing needs.
| SLA | MJF | SLS | SLM | |
|---|---|---|---|---|
| Min. Wall Thickness | 0.6mm for unsupported walls, 0.4mm for supported walls on both sides | At least 1mm thick; avoid overly thick walls | From 0.7mm (PA 12) to 2.0mm (carbon-filled polyamide) | 0.8 mm |
| Layer Height | 25 µm to 100µm | Around 80µm | 100–120 microns | 30 – 50μm |
| Max. Build Size | 1400x700x500mm | 264x343x348mm | 380x280x380mm | 320x320x400mm |
| Dimension Tolerance | ±0.2mm (For >100mm, apply 0.15%) | ±0.2mm (For >100mm, apply 0.25%) | ± 0.3mm (For >100mm, apply 0.35%) | ±0.2mm (For >100mm, apply 0.25%) |
| Standard Lead Time | 4 business days | 5 business days | 6 business days | 6 business days |
| Surface Finish (Ra) | Normal: 3.2μm After polishing: 1.6μm | 3.2–6.3μm (No secondary processing for nylon) | 3.2–6.3μm (Polishing/grinding available) | 3.2–6.3μm (Polishing/grinding available) |
